Dragon Age 3: Inquisition Announced

News by XboxBetty on  Sep 17, 2012

The role-playing game Dragon Age 3: Inquisition was announced today by BioWare. According to the press release BioWare's Dragon Age team has been working on the game for about two years. BioWare has been taking player feedback from fans into account while making the game, saying:

"We’ve been poring over player feedback from past games and connecting directly with our fans. They haven’t held back, so we’re not either. With Dragon Age 3: Inquisition, we want to give fans what they’re asking for – a great story with choices that matter, a massive world to explore, deep customization and combat that is both tactical and visceral.”




The Dragon Age franchise has sold over 8 million copies.



BioWare says they have been working with DICE to make Frostbite 2 the foundation for the games power engine. They plan to use new technology to make Dragon Age 3: Inquisition's vision fully realized.

The game is planned to release in late 2013. For updates stay tuned to NoobFeed and visit the game's official website.
